Thursday, May 27, 1926
Fine weather.
Work on:
(1) G 7000 X
(1) G 7000 X
With photo *A3843 continued removal of No. 487 (28)-(41) part of the wing.
*B5967
While waiting for the print, we went on with:
No. 484: (73)-(92) inlays northwest of wing.
Print arrived and resumed on wing.
No. 487: (42)-(48) supplementary plan
No. 487: (49)-(60)
Cleaned up wood dust, etc.
*B5968
Afternoon, working with print *B5968.
No. 487: (61)-(70)
Removed wood, core of wing (486) and removed No. 487 (71)-(77) small pieces belonging to (487).
Cleaned up back of lower face of wing.
*A3844
Wheeler finished plan 1:1 of lower face of wing.
Cleaned up along wall, the continuation of (Z)-4.
*A5969
Friday, May 28, 1926
Fine, cool weather.
Work on:
(1) G 7000 X.
(1) G 7000 X
Proceeded with continuation of (Z)-4 along west wall
No. 489: (1)-(22), (17), (21), (22) were from (L).
The frame of (Z)-4 was engaged on south and could not be lifted (see Photo *5969).
Proceeded to take up other side of wing (that which was face down, and set it together.
No. 490: (1)-(4) wing.
On taking up (4), this came with it (stuck to it by patina).
No. 491: Gold ribbon, 25 x 1.15 cm
No. 490: (5)-(14)
(9)-(14) were stuck together by patina of strips and came up as one piece. To it was stuck 492, 493 and three inlays of (S). [(S) is a long staff or handle which runs under 490 and on southwards. It is inlaid with small very thin inlays set in]
